Transaction 874a33b5931141fe591e01a425f8bcc44909b5c645cdda8b44126d4e2f49f9f5
1 Input
1 Output
-
874a33b5931141fe591e01a425f8bcc44909b5c645cdda8b44126d4e2f49f9f5:0
- value
- 3363195
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4ef048ba5db4e4de40cf52a5f1d3d4852e080584 OP_EQUAL
- address
- 38tQUjm39bf9FNtPZy96o7eK8GZbqCWYsW